Florida
Champions Gate
David's Club - Omni Orlando Resorts
David's Club - Omni Orlando Resorts
no phone number
1500 Masters Blvd, Champions Gate, FL 33896
Own this business?
Learn more
about offering online ordering to your diners.
American
Menu not currently available